本发明涉及物料编码,尤其涉及一种订单转换方法、装置及计算机可读存储介质。
背景技术:
1、物料编码是企业实施信息化建设、应用erp的重要基础,是信息管理基础工作中必不可少的重要环节。企业通过物料编码信息实现对物料的生产、采购、物料跟踪、信息追溯、成本核算等工作。在相关技术中,其他企业向当前企业发送订单中会包含其他企业对订单中物料的物料编码,由于两个企业之间物料规则的不同,导致当前企业还需要对接收订单中的物料信息重新进行识别,导致当企业的订单处理效率太低。
2、上述内容仅用于辅助理解本发明的技术方案,并不代表承认上述内容是现有技术。
技术实现思路
1、本发明的主要目的在于提供一种订单转换方法、装置及计算机可读存储介质,旨在达成提高企业处理交易订单的效率的效果。
2、为实现上述目的,本发明提供一种订单转换方法,所述订单转换方法包括:
3、接收订单生成节点发送的物料订单,并确定所述物料订单中的物料编码,以及确定所述物料订单对应的接收节点;
4、根据所述生成节点对应的第一编码规则和所述物料编码,确定物料信息;
5、根据所述物料信息和所述接收节点对应的第二编码规则生成目标物料编码;
6、根据所述目标物料编码将所述物料订单转换为目标物料订单,并将所述目标物料订单发送至所述接收节点。
7、可选地,所述根据所述物料信息和所述接收节点对应的第二编码规则生成目标物料编码的步骤包括:
8、根据所述第一编码规则编码确定所述物料对应的订单物料;
9、获取所述订单物料关联的说明信息作为所述物料信息。
10、可选地,所述根据所述物料信息和所述接收节点对应的第二编码规则生成目标物料编码的步骤包括:
11、根据所述第一编码规则确定所述物料编码中各个字符的表示信息;
12、将所述表示信息作为所述物料信息。
13、可选地,所述根据所述物料信息和所述接收节点对应的第二编码规则生成目标物料编码的步骤包括:
14、确定所述第二编码规则对应的目标信息类型,以及所述物料信息对应的信息类型;
15、将所述信息类型与所述目标信息类型逐一进行匹配;
16、根据匹配结果确定所述目标信息类型对应的目标物料信息;
17、根据所述目标物料信息和所述第二编码规则确定对应的目标物料编码。
18、可选地,所述根据匹配结果确定所述目标信息对象对应的目标物料信息的步骤,还包括:
19、当所述信息类型与所述目标信息类型一致时,将所述信息类型对应的物料信息,作为所述目标信息类型对应的目标物料信息;
20、当所述信息类型与所述目标信号类型不一致时,向所述生成节点获取所述目标信息类型对应的目标物料信息。
21、可选地,所述根据所述目标物料信息和所述第二编码规则确定对应的目标物料编码的步骤包括:
22、根据所有所述目标物料信息和所述第二编码规则确定所述目标信息类型对应的目标字符;
23、根据所述第二编码规则确定所述目标字符的顺序;
24、根据所述顺序和目标字符生成所述目标物料编码。
25、可选地,所述向所述生成节点获取所述目标信息类型对应的目标物料信息的步骤之前,还包括:
26、确定所述目标信息类型对应的预设规则类型;
27、当所述规则类型为基于具体信息确定时,执行所述基于所述目标信息类型向所述第一终端发送物料信息查询请求的步骤;
28、当所述规则类型为基于其他目标字符确定时,在所述其他编码确定成功后,基于所述其他编码确定所述目标字符。
29、可选地,所述根据所述目标物料编码将所述物料订单转换为目标物料订单,并将所述目标物料订单发送至所述接收节点的步骤包括:
30、将所述物料订单中对应物料编码,全局对应替换为所述物料编码对应的目标物料编码,得到所述目标物料订单;
31、将所述目标物料订单发送至所述接收节点。
32、此外,为实现上述目的,本发明还提供一种订单转换装置,所述订单转换装置包括存储器、处理器及存储在所述存储器上并可在所述处理器上运行的订单转换程序,所述订单转换程序被所述处理器执行时实现如上所述的订单转换方法的步骤。
33、此外,为实现上述目的,本发明还提供一种计算机可读存储介质,所述计算机可读存储介质上存储有订单转换程序,所述订单转换程序被处理器执行时实现如上所述的订单转换方法的步骤。
34、本发明实施例提出的一种订单转换方法、装置及计算机可读存储介质,先接收订单生成节点发送的物料订单,并确定所述物料订单中的物料编码,以及确定所述物料订单对应的接收节点;根据所述生成节点对应的第一编码规则和所述物料编码,确定物料信息;根据所述物料信息和所述接收节点对应的第二编码规则生成目标物料编码;根据所述目标物料编码将所述物料订单转换为目标物料订单,并将所述目标物料订单发送至所述接收节点。这样在将生成节点的物料订单发送给接收节点之前,基于目标物料编码将物料订单转换为目标物料订单,使得接收节点可以直接基于目标物料编码处理目标物料订单,从而提高企业处理交易订单的效率。
1.一种订单转换方法,其特征在于,所述订单转换方法包括:
2.如权利要求1所述的订单转换方法,其特征在于,所述根据所述物料信息和所述接收节点对应的第二编码规则生成目标物料编码的步骤包括:
3.如权利要求1所述的订单转换方法,其特征在于,所述根据所述物料信息和所述接收节点对应的第二编码规则生成目标物料编码的步骤包括:
4.如权利要求2-3任意一项所述的订单转换方法,其特征在于,所述根据所述物料信息和所述接收节点对应的第二编码规则生成目标物料编码的步骤包括:
5.如权利要求4所述的订单转换方法,其特征在于,所述根据匹配结果确定所述目标信息对象对应的目标物料信息的步骤,还包括:
6.如权利要求5所述的订单转换方法,其特征在于,所述根据所述目标物料信息和所述第二编码规则确定对应的目标物料编码的步骤包括:
7.如权利要求4所述的订单转换方法,其特征在于,所述向所述生成节点获取所述目标信息类型对应的目标物料信息的步骤之前,还包括:
8.如权利要求1所述的订单转换方法,其特征在于,所述根据所述目标物料编码将所述物料订单转换为目标物料订单,并将所述目标物料订单发送至所述接收节点的步骤包括:
9.一种订单转换装置,其特征在于,所述订单转换装置包括:存储器、处理器及存储在所述存储器上并可在所述处理器上运行的订单转换程序,所述订单转换程序被所述处理器执行时实现如权利要求1至8中任一项所述的订单转换方法的步骤。
10.一种计算机可读存储介质,其特征在于,所述计算机可读存储介质上存储有订单转换程序,所述订单转换程序被处理器执行时实现如权利要求1至8中任一项所述的订单转换方法的步骤。